The Creator Problem

The content treadmill keeps asking for the next upload. Meanwhile, the archive keeps getting deeper: old favorites, sleeper hits, divisive episodes, and videos newer viewers may never find on their own.

The work still has value. The problem is giving people a reason to return to it.

Brackeroni gives that archive a structure: one pool of videos, weekly matchups, round-by-round reveals, and one final audience favorite.

Run the vote in Brackeroni. Let YouTube handle the reactions.

How It Works

  1. 1

    Add the importer

    Drag the bookmarklet to your bookmarks bar so you can send video pages to Brackeroni.

  2. 2

    Import your archive

    Open your channel, playlist, or video archive and pull your videos into a pool.

  3. 3

    Shape the pool for your audience

    Review the videos, edit titles, add thumbnails, tag the entries, keep the ones that fit, and seed the matchups if you want.

  4. 4

    Run the weekly bracket

    Create a bracket with one final winner, open the round for voting, then reveal what advanced in your next episode.
